Israel Escalates Attack on Lebanon, Threatens Beirut

AntiWar.com reports: “House To Vote This Week on Bill To End Support for Israel’s War on Lebanon” and “Netanyahu Orders Attack on Beirut as Israeli Strikes Kill 12 in South Lebanon.” See footage of Israeli bombing a hospital and a daycare center

The outlet also reports: “Iranian Parliament Speaker Mohammad Bagher Ghalibaf said on Monday that Iran would be in a ‘direct confrontation with the enemy’ if Israel doesn’t halt its attacks in Lebanon.

“Ghalibaf made the comments in a post on X recounting a conversation he had with Nabih Berri, the speaker of Lebanon’s parliament and leader of the Amal Movement, a Shia political faction that’s largely aligned with Hezbollah. ..

“Trump claimed in two posts on Truth Social after his call with Netanyahu that some sort of ceasefire had been agreed to, though Israeli attacks continue in southern Lebanon and Hezbollah continues to fire at Israeli forces. …

“Axios reported that Trump had lashed out at Netanyahu during the call, calling him ‘fucking crazy’ over Israel’s escalations in Lebanon, but, according to Israeli media reports, the US and Israel have previously put out leaks about the two leaders being at odds to keep Iran off guard. An Israeli official also told Ynet earlier on Monday that Israel had coordinated with the U.S. on the threat to attack Beirut.” 

Trump claims Israel and Hezbollah have agreed to de-escalate, but neither Israel nor Hezbollah has confirmed the existence of an agreement. See briefing by Dave DeCamp, who questions whether the U.S. government has any contact with Hezbollah.
